Best Practices for Custom Helpers in Laravel 5

后端 未结 20 2266
暖寄归人
暖寄归人 2020-11-22 06:40

I would like to create helper functions to avoid repeating code between views in Laravel 5:

view.blade.php

Foo Formated text: {{ fo

20条回答
  •  一整个雨季
    2020-11-22 07:17

    Create Helpers.php in app/Helper/Helpers.php

    namespace App\Helper
    class Helpers
    {
    
    
    }
    

    Add in composer and composer update

     "autoload": {
            "classmap": [
                "database/seeds",
                "database/factories",
                "database","app/Helper/Helpers.php"
            ],
            "psr-4": {
                "App\\": "app/"
            },
             "files": ["app/Helper/Helpers.php"]
        },
    

    use in Controller

    use App\Helper\Helpers

    use in view change in config->app.php file

       'aliases' => [
        ...
        'Helpers'   => 'App\Helper\Helpers'
        ],
    

    call in view

    
    

提交回复
热议问题